The son of Shriji Arvind Singh Mewar and executive director of the luxury HRH Group of Hotels, Lakshyaraj Singh Mewar is known as a keen sportsman, art collector and philanthropist

What do you know about Udaipur? India’s “City of Lakes” is renowned for the calming artificial water bodies which characterise the historic city. Sitting at the south of the modern day state of Rajasthan, the city has been at the heartland of the Mewar dynasty from the start, making it one of the grandest regions in a country famous for big imperial palaces.

This is where Lakshyaraj Singh Mewar hails from, and the prince is a staunch advocate of repurposing the city’s sublime palaces as supreme heritage hotels – and putting them on the world map.
